/* * log.c	Logging module. * * Version:	$Id: log.c,v 1.63 2008/03/07 11:12:09 aland Exp $ * *   This program is free software; you can redistribute it and/or modify *   it under the terms of the GNU General Public License as published by *   the Free Software Foundation; either version 2 of the License, or *   (at your option) any later version. * *   This program is distributed in the hope that it will be useful, *   but WITHOUT ANY WARRANTY; without even the implied warranty of *   M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E.  See the *   GNU General Public License for more details. * *   You should have received a copy of the GNU General Public License *   along with this program; if not, write to the Free Software *   Foundation, Inc., 51 Franklin St, Fifth Floor, Boston, MA 02110-1301, USA * * Copyright 2001,2006  The FreeRADIUS server project * Copyright 2000  Miquel van Smoorenburg <miquels@cistron.nl> * Copyright 2000  Alan DeKok <aland@ox.org> * Copyright 2001  Chad Miller <cmiller@surfsouth.com> */#include <freeradius-devel/ident.h>RCSID("$Id: log.c,v 1.63 2008/03/07 11:12:09 aland Exp $")#include <freeradius-devel/radiusd.h>#ifdef HAVE_SYS_STAT_H#include <sys/stat.h>#endif#ifdef HAVE_SYSLOG_H#	include <syslog.h>/* keep track of whether we've run openlog() */static int openlog_run = 0;#endifstatic int can_update_log_fp = TRUE;static FILE *log_fp = NULL;/* * Logging facility names */static const FR_NAME_NUMBER levels[] = {	{ ": Debug: ",          L_DBG   },	{ ": Auth: ",           L_AUTH  },	{ ": Proxy: ",          L_PROXY },	{ ": Info: ",           L_INFO  },	{ ": Acct: ",           L_ACCT  },	{ ": Error: ",          L_ERR   },	{ NULL, 0 }};/* *	Log the message to the logfile. Include the severity and *	a time stamp. */int vradlog(int lvl, const char *fmt, va_list ap){	struct main_config_t *myconfig = &mainconfig;	int fd = myconfig->radlog_fd;	FILE *fp = NULL;	unsigned char *p;	char buffer[8192];	int len, print_timestamp = 0;	/*	 *	NOT debugging, and trying to log debug messages.	 *	 *	Throw the message away.	 */	if (!debug_flag && (lvl == L_DBG)) {		return 0;	}	/*	 *	If we don't want any messages, then	 *	throw them away.	 */	if (myconfig->radlog_dest == RADLOG_NULL) {		return 0;	}	/*	 *	Don't print timestamps to syslog, it does that for us.	 *	Don't print timestamps for low levels of debugging.	 *	 *	Print timestamps for non-debugging, and for high levels	 *	of debugging.	 */	if ((myconfig->radlog_dest != RADLOG_SYSLOG) &&	    (debug_flag != 1) && (debug_flag != 2)) {		print_timestamp = 1;	}	if ((fd != -1) &&	    (myconfig->radlog_dest != RADLOG_STDOUT) &&	    (myconfig->radlog_dest != RADLOG_STDERR)) {		myconfig->radlog_fd = -1;		fd = -1;	}	*buffer = '\0';	len = 0;	if (fd != -1) {		/*		 *	Use it, rather than anything else.		 */#ifdef HAVE_SYSLOG_H	} else if (myconfig->radlog_dest == RADLOG_SYSLOG) {		/*		 *	Open run openlog() on the first log message		 */		if(!openlog_run) {			openlog(progname, LOG_PID, myconfig->syslog_facility);			openlog_run = 1;		}#endif	} else if (myconfig->radlog_dest == RADLOG_FILES) {		if (!myconfig->log_file) {			/*			 *	Errors go to stderr, in the hope that			 *	they will be printed somewhere.			 */			if (lvl & L_ERR) {				fd = STDERR_FILENO;				print_timestamp = 0;				snprintf(buffer, sizeof(buffer), "%s: ", progname);				len = strlen(buffer);			} else {				/*				 *	No log file set.  Discard it.				 */				return 0;			}					} else if (log_fp) {			struct stat buf;			if (stat(myconfig->log_file, &buf) < 0) {				fclose(log_fp);				log_fp = fr_log_fp = NULL;			}		}		if (!log_fp) {			fp = fopen(myconfig->log_file, "a");			if (!fp) {				fprintf(stderr, "%s: Couldn't open %s for logging: %s\n",					progname, myconfig->log_file, strerror(errno));								fprintf(stderr, "  (");				vfprintf(stderr, fmt, ap);  /* the message that caused the log */				fprintf(stderr, ")\n");				return -1;			}			setlinebuf(fp);		}		/*		 *	We can only set the global variable log_fp IF		 *	we have no child threads.  If we do have child		 *	threads, each thread has to open it's own FP.		 */		if (can_update_log_fp && fp) fr_log_fp = log_fp = fp;	}	if (print_timestamp) {		const char *s;		time_t timeval;		timeval = time(NULL);		CTIME_R(&timeval, buffer + len, sizeof(buffer) - len - 1);		s = fr_int2str(levels, (lvl & ~L_CONS), ": ");		strcat(buffer, s);		len = strlen(buffer);	}	vsnprintf(buffer + len, sizeof(buffer) - len - 1, fmt, ap);	/*	 *	Filter out characters not in Latin-1.	 */	for (p = (unsigned char *)buffer; *p != '\0'; p++) {		if (*p == '\r' || *p == '\n')			*p = ' ';		else if (*p == '\t') continue;		else if (*p < 32 || (*p >= 128 && *p <= 160))			*p = '?';	}	strcat(buffer, "\n");#ifdef HAVE_SYSLOG_H	if (myconfig->radlog_dest == RADLOG_SYSLOG) {		switch(lvl & ~L_CONS) {			case L_DBG:				lvl = LOG_DEBUG;				break;			case L_AUTH:				lvl = LOG_NOTICE;				break;			case L_PROXY:				lvl = LOG_NOTICE;				break;			case L_ACCT:				lvl = LOG_NOTICE;				break;			case L_INFO:				lvl = LOG_INFO;				break;			case L_ERR:				lvl = LOG_ERR;				break;		}		syslog(lvl, "%s", buffer);	} else#endif	if (log_fp != NULL) {		fputs(buffer, log_fp);	} else if (fp != NULL) {		fputs(buffer, fp);		fclose(fp);	} else if (fd >= 0) {		write(fd, buffer, strlen(buffer));	}	return 0;}int log_debug(const char *msg, ...){	va_list ap;	int r;	va_start(ap, msg);	r = vradlog(L_DBG, msg, ap);	va_end(ap);	return r;}int radlog(int lvl, const char *msg, ...){	va_list ap;	int r;	va_start(ap, msg);	r = vradlog(lvl, msg, ap);	va_end(ap);	return r;}/* *      Dump a whole list of attributes to DEBUG2 */void vp_listdebug(VALUE_PAIR *vp){        char tmpPair[70];        for (; vp; vp = vp->next) {                vp_prints(tmpPair, sizeof(tmpPair), vp);                DEBUG2("     %s", tmpPair);        }}/* *	If the server is running with multiple threads, signal the log *	subsystem that we're about to START multiple threads.  Once *	that happens, we can no longer open/close the log_fp in a *	child thread, as writing to global variables causes a race *	condition. * *	We also close the fr_log_fp, as it can no longer write to the *	log file (if any). * *	All of this work is because we want to catch the case of the *	administrator deleting the log file.  If that happens, we want *	the logs to go to the *new* file, and not the *old* one. */void force_log_reopen(void){	can_update_log_fp = 0;	if (mainconfig.radlog_dest != RADLOG_FILES) return;	if (log_fp) fclose(log_fp);	fr_log_fp = log_fp = NULL;}
